CAIRO: A ferry carrying 1230 passengers caught fire early Thursday morning while traveling to Egypt from the Jordanian port Aqaba. The Egyptian ferry, Billa, caught fire some 20 miles offshore of Aqaba while en route to the port of Nuweiba on the Sinai Peninsula. “Arabian Bridge”, the company that owns Billa, sent two more ferries from its fleet to rescue the passengers from the burning vessel. The passengers were rescued without any casualties and 80 percent of the fire has been suppressed according to the Ministry of Transportation in a press release earlier in the day. BM
